what's the square root of 135

Respuesta :

Lilith
Lilith Lilith
  • 03-06-2014
[tex]\sqrt{ 135}=\sqrt{9\cdot 15}=3\sqrt{15}=3\cdot 3.873 \approx 11.62[/tex]
